My stay at the "Baileyville" Cottage was exactly what I needed—a serene escape in a beautiful location. Nestled on the shores of Beseck Lake, this cozy cottage is perfect for a solo traveler or a couple looking to unwind and relax.
The cottage itself is small but well-appointed, with an updated interior that strikes a balance between modern comfort and rustic charm. The highlight for me was the full floor-to-ceiling glass doors facing the lakefront. Waking up to the sight of the lake and being able to step outside to the fresh air was truly rejuvenating.
I chose this spot as a peaceful retreat after attending the Travelers Championship, and it exceeded my expectations. Each evening, I enjoyed sitting by the lake, soaking in the tranquility and natural beauty around me. It was the perfect way to unwind after a busy day.
While my experience was overwhelmingly positive, there were a couple of minor drawbacks worth mentioning. The roofline windows do not have blinds, which meant the morning light could be quite bright. Additionally, the light from the safety light outside could be a bit bothersome at night. However, these were small inconveniences in an otherwise delightful stay.
Overall, the "Baileyville" Cottage on Beseck Lake is a gem of a find—a cozy, well-maintained retreat in a stunning location. I would gladly return for another stay and recommend it to anyone looking for a peaceful getaway in the area.
